Komentáre v html a php. Komentáre v HTML, CSS, PHP

25.04.2017


Ahojte všetci!
Pokračujte v učení základov PHP od začiatku!
V tomto návode vám poviem, čo je komentár v PHP a v praxi sa pokúsime napísať náš komentár do kódu. To však nie je všetko. Chcem vám tiež povedať, ako komentovať kód a prečo to vôbec musíte urobiť.

V čom je komentárPHP
Komentujte vPHP- toto je pomôcka php vývojára pre rýchlu navigáciu v kóde, ako aj pre úpravy.

Komentár v PHP nie je viditeľný pre používateľa, ktorý otvoril webovú stránku na prezeranie. Aj keď sa používateľ rozhodne pozrieť si zdrojový kód stránky, komentár stále nebude viditeľný, pretože všetky php.

Komentár PHP kódu

Existujú 2 druhy komentárov pre kód PHP:

→ jeden riadok
→ viacriadkový

⇒ Jednoriadkový komentár pre PHP
Pre jednoriadkový komentár použite symboly "//" alebo "#"

Po týchto znakoch bude všetko napísané na jednom riadku ignorované a považované za komentár.

Prihlásiť sa na odber aktualizácie "; # odber (toto je komentár)?>


Prihláste sa na odber aktualizácie

⇒ Viacriadkový komentár pre PHP
Viacriadkový komentár pre PHP začína znakom "/ *" a končí znakom "* /".
Čokoľvek medzi týmito znakmi bude ignorované a bude sa s tým zaobchádzať ako s komentárom.
Ak je v zázname viac riadkov, použije sa viacriadkový komentár.

Na obrazovke uvidíte iba nasledujúci text:

Ahojte čitatelia blogu - stránka!!!

P.S.: Vždy komentujte svoj kód. Ak si myslíte, že všetko, čo ste v kóde urobili, si zapamätáte o 1-2 roky, ste na omyle, šanca je veľmi malá. Aj keď si pamätáte, budete musieť stráviť veľa času štúdiom toho, čo, kde a prečo ...
Urobte pre seba v budúcnosti niečo príjemné - okomentujte kód a potom si poviete „ĎAKUJEM!!!“.
Zanechajte komentár v kóde, zaberie to 1 minútu, ale ušetrí vám to celý deň v budúcnosti.

Komentujte PHP kód

Povedzme, že ste napísali php kód, ale z nejakého dôvodu musíte z kódu odstrániť 2 riadky.
Neponáhľam sa s odstránením niečoho z kódu, najmä ak ide o kód php, radšej by som to okomentoval. Čo ak potrebujete vrátiť kód. Je jednoduchšie odkomentovať, ako napísať kód novým spôsobom.

Ako zakomentovať kódPHP
Príklad s jednoriadkovým komentárom:

Prihláste sa na odber aktualizácie ";?>

Príklad s viacriadkovým komentárom.

Od autora: komentovanie je jednou z tých funkcií, ktoré sa ľahko implementujú. Zároveň môžu byť tieto editačné prvky veľkým prínosom pre vývojárov, ktorí si svoj kód odovzdávajú z ruky do ruky. Dnes sa naučíte, ako komentovať blok v PhpStorm. Zvážime aj zvyšok funkcionality vývojového prostredia na komentovanie obsahu programu.

Komentáre: dobré a zlé

Komentovanie kódu je dostupné vo väčšine programovacích jazykov (možno vo všetkých, ale s rôznou mierou dostupnosti). Verbálne vysvetlenia sa zvyčajne používajú na to, aby pomohli ostatným členom tímu v ďalšom rozvoji, alebo si jednoducho pripomenuli, že táto oblasť potrebuje opravy („FIX ME“).

Samozrejme, vysvetlenie toho, čo je napísané, je požehnaním. Ale pomocou komentárov môžete preškrtnúť aj všetky dobré stránky kódu. Aby sa tomu zabránilo, je potrebné rozlišovať medzi typmi komentárov:

dokumentovanie. Dobrým spojením by bol koncept dokumentácie pre rôzny softvér. Takéto komentáre vám pomôžu použiť kód ako pokyn. Takéto komentovanie nie je vnímané ako zbytočné, pretože bez neho nie je nič. Predstavte si, že niekto použil rámec na tvorbu obsahu a nepovie vám, ako program používať;

JavaScript. Rýchly štart

vysvetľovanie. Dobrý kód ich zvyčajne nepotrebuje. Čím viac riadkov komentárov v programe vidíte, tým je pravdepodobnejšie, že je program zle napísaný. Samozrejme, nie je to absolútne pravidlo.

Vysvetľujúce komentáre môžu byť užitočné pre tých, ktorí v budúcnosti opravia kód. Napríklad veľa mladých odborníkov všade vidí pole na zlepšenie. Veria, že pred nimi to bolo horšie a teraz je čas opraviť každú jednu vlastnosť.

Niekedy podobný pocit premôže aj profesionálov. Napríklad, keď všetko vyzerá prekvapivo krivo, musí existovať lepšie riešenie. Ak chcete zabrániť sledovateľom, aby hľadali to najlepšie, programátor môže zanechať poznámku takto: # time_spent_here = 24h

Po takýchto slovách sa málokomu chce venovať toľko času. Preto varujete, že veľa rôznych možností už bolo vyriešených. Zároveň by ste sa mali vyhnúť takýmto útokom: #i_hate_this, # try_to_do_better_ass %% le. Týmto spôsobom len prejavujete neprofesionálny prístup. Nekompromitujte seba a svojho zamestnávateľa.

Ale dokumentárne komentovanie kódu sa môže stať balastom pre programátora. Spravidla ide o masívne sekcie, ktoré odvádzajú pozornosť priamo od programovania. Aby sa však kód zobrazil bez komentárov, hlavné IDE majú zodpovedajúcu funkciu. PhpStorm by nemal byť výnimkou, ale bohužiaľ. Vyhľadajte funkciu v aktualizačných dokumentoch.

Tag ako funkčný prvok

Zatiaľ čo komentovanie má byť vysvetlením a pomôckou pri rozvoji tímu, tieto funkcie sa bežne nepoužívajú. Značky sa spravidla umiestňujú tam, kde chcú zastaviť vykonávanie kódu. Povedzme, že máte PHP vložené do HTML. A vy to nechcete vymazať, chcete len vidieť, ako stránka vyzerá bez toho. Ak to chcete urobiť, musíte postupovať podľa nasledujúcej syntaxe:

JavaScript

...
...

…< div > . . . < / div >

< ? -- закомментированныйкоднаphp -- >

< div > . . . < / div >

Ako vidíte, pomocou jednoduchých akcií môžete zastaviť vykonávanie kódu bez toho, aby ste vykonali akékoľvek zložité operácie. Ale v skutočnosti to ešte nie je vrchol optimalizácie. Ďalšie pohodlie pre vývojárov poskytuje samotné phpStorm IDE. Pomocou zvýrazňovania a klávesových skratiek môžete komentovať vybraný segment kódu bez pripájania špecializovaných značiek. Dá sa to urobiť nasledovne.

Pomocou pre vás vhodnej metódy vyberte fragment textu (myš, skratky).

Stlačte klávesovú skratku Ctr + Shift + /

Okrem toho môžete komentovať aktuálny riadok. Všetko je po starom, len bez Shiftu.

Výhodou tohto typu komentovania je súčasné pokrytie viacerých jazykov. PHP je málokedy samo o sebe. Týmto spôsobom sa nemusíte uchýliť k označovaniu každého z nich. Prostredie podporuje niekoľko ďalších webových jazykov. Stačí vybrať fragment a predať kombináciu - toto je viacjazyčný kód a zakomentovaný. Rovnakým spôsobom ho možno aktivovať.

To je z našej strany všetko. Ak ste tieto funkcie ešte nepoužívali, odporúčame vám začať. Skratky urýchľujú a zlepšujú prácu.

JavaScript. Rýchly štart

Naučte sa základy JavaScriptu pomocou praktického príkladu vytvárania webovej aplikácie

Komentáre v PHP sú podobné komentárom používaným v HTML. V syntaxi PHP komentáre vždy začínajú špeciálnou sekvenciou znakov a všetok text, ktorý sa objaví medzi týmito špeciálnymi znakmi, bude interpret ignorovať.

V HTML je hlavným účelom komentára slúžiť ako poznámka pre vývojárov, ktorí môžu zobraziť zdrojový kód vašej stránky. Komentáre PHP sa líšia tým, že sa návštevníkom nezobrazia. Jediný spôsob, ako zobraziť komentáre PHP, je otvoriť súbor na úpravu. Vďaka tomu sú komentáre PHP užitočné iba pre programátorov PHP.

V prípade, že ste zabudli alebo ste nevedeli, ako sa vytvárajú komentáre v HTML, pozrite si príklad nižšie.

Syntax komentára PHP: jednoriadkový komentár

Zatiaľ čo html má iba jeden druh komentárov, PHP má dva. Prvým typom, o ktorom budeme diskutovať, je jednoriadkový komentár. Teda komentár, ktorý tlmočníkovi povie, aby ignoroval všetko, čo sa deje na tomto riadku napravo od komentárov. Ak chcete použiť tento komentár, použite znaky "//" alebo "#" a všetok text napravo bude PHP interpret ignorovať.

Psst ... Nemôžete "vidieť moje komentáre PHP!"; // echo "nič"; // echo "Volám sa Humperdinkle!"; # echo "Nerobím" ani nič ";?>

výsledok:

Ahoj svet! Psst ... Nevidíte moje komentáre PHP!

Všimnite si, že niekoľko našich príkazov echo nebolo spracovaných, pretože sme ich okomentovali špeciálnymi znakmi komentára. Tento typ komentára sa často používa na rýchle napísanie zložitého a mätúceho kódu alebo na dočasné odstránenie riadku kódu PHP (na ladenie).

Syntax komentára PHP: viacriadkový komentár

Podobne ako HTML komentáre, aj PHP viacriadkové komentáre možno použiť na komentovanie veľkých blokov kódu alebo na písanie komentárov cez viacero riadkov. Viacriadkové komentáre v PHP začínajú "/ *" a končia "* /". Čokoľvek medzi týmito znakmi bude ignorované.

Výsledok.

... dnes v tomto krátkom, ale užitočnom článku prídeme na to, ako sa komentuje odlišný programový kód. Nebudem veľa hovoriť, pretože ak vás to zaujíma, už ste sa stretli s otázkami tohto problému a máte o tom predstavu.


Prišli ste na adresu ... ale pár slov pre jasnosť a prospech prípadu. Pravdepodobne ste videli, ako sa to robí s kódom CSS, pretože css najviac zaujíma mnohých začiatočníkov, ako som ja.

… Dobre!

Upozorňujeme však, že komentáre sa používajú aj v html a php... Ale väčšina začiatočníkov je zmätená v počiatočnej fáze svojej práce s webom a nevie, ako si pre seba pridať potrebné vysvetlenia. Koniec koncov, stane sa to tak, že napríklad musíte na nejaký čas deaktivovať html kód, a potom znova obnoviť jeho funkciu - je ľahké ho implementovať, ak ste si urobili poznámky pre seba na "okrajoch", ale nikdy neviete čo.

Čo by sa však malo pamätať na „komentáre“ vo všeobecnosti - tu je všetko prísne závislé od toho, s ktorým súborom konkrétne pracujete, a preto je kód aplikácie odlišný.

Komentovanie kódu CSS

a: vznášanie sa, a: zameranie (farba: # D5071E; dekorácia textu: Overline; / * PODČIARKNUTIE * /)

Takto si vysvetľuješ sám seba. Alebo môžete tento skript css dokonca komentovať takto: jednoducho zabaliť

/ * tu KÓD * /

/ * a: podržte kurzor myši, a: zameranie (farba: # D5071E; dekorácia textu: podčiarknutie; / * PODČIARKNUTIE * /) * /

Upozorňujem na skutočnosť, že - takto môžete komentovať celý cyklus css kódu, ale !! potom musíte odstrániť opakované komentáre / * PODČIARKNÚŤ DONO * /, alebo sa pohrať s lomkami, ak je vysvetlenie dôležité))

V opačnom prípade dôjde k chybe!!

Poznámka:

Ak otvoríte zdrojový kód stránky - Ctrl + U a pozriete sa ... uvidíme, že zakomentovaný kúsok css kódu sa krásne zobrazí vo vygenerovanom dokumente! to je, ak bol css použitý (vlastnosti boli nastavené) priamo v html

A ako viete, ak prejdete zo zdrojového kódu odkazom na css dokument vašej aktívnej šablóny, všetky komentáre možno pozorovať a študovať)), ak to niekto potrebuje. Ale to je nepravdepodobné)

Anglické príslovky (slová) budú čitateľné. Ruská symbolika - č.

Komentovanie HTML kódu

Súbor XML je komentovaný rovnakým spôsobom.

Dôležité: vždy skontrolujte kód uvedený v článkoch, aspoň vizuálne), inak sa môžu vyskytnúť chyby.

Obvyklá neopatrnosť pri formátovaní môže byť časovo náročná, napríklad kód KOMENTOVANÝ vyššie je často chybný: namiesto dvoch krátkych pomlčiek sa zobrazí em pomlčka:

Pre tvoju informáciu:

ako bolo povedané v predchádzajúcej poznámke - taký je komentár ... vo vygenerovanom dokumente sa zobrazí html kód!

Majte to na pamäti.

A tu je ďalšia vec:

okrem toho, že komentovaný kód je zobrazený v zdrojovom kóde stránky (čo znamená, že je v istom zmysle spracovaný, aj keď na stránke bude neviditeľný!) - je lepšie odstrániť niektoré php funkcie v spojení s html z aktívneho dokumentu.

Napríklad:

budú viditeľné v dokumente a vo funkciibude to fungovať úžasne: to znamená, že informácie neuvidíte vo frontende, ale v zdroji - budú jasne zobrazené! a to je bespontovy dotaz do databazy: toto vsetko je malickost, ale treba to vediet!

Je to možné, ak nechcete z dokumentu vyberať časť kódu:

pridajte pred potrebný „extra“ html kód otvorenie... inline funkcia ... a zatváranie?> ...

Jedným slovom, takto to môžete urobiť, ak je kód veľký:


**/ ?>

potom bude zdroj čistý!

Alebo jednoduchšie:

Vyjadrime sa k samotnej funkcii v html dokumente. Zdrojový kód v týchto prípadoch bude čistý s ohľadom na vývoj funkcií!

ako komentovať JavaScript

if (beingShown || zobrazený) (// nespustí animáciu znova return;) else (// v riadku použije ANY COMMENT // v riadku použije ANY COMMENT // true;

Kvôli prehľadnosti som schmatol tento príklad kódu JavaScript v sieti a mierne som upravil interpunkciu. Nevadí... Hlavná vec je pochopiť princíp...

Ako ste pochopili, lomka "//" je dvojitá, toto je ZNAMKO komentára ... JEDEN RIADOK!

Zvyšok kódu JS je komentovaný ako php, viac o tom nižšie:

poznámka:

Komentovanie kódu PHP

... a ... tu je to to isté - lomka-lomka ... jednoriadková.

Všimnite si však, že môže byť anotovaný rovnako ako kód CSS.

... alebo tak môžete komentovať - ​​možnosť s jedným riadkom, keď pred komentovaným riadkom použijeme NIE DVE lomítka, ale BECAR (hash):

... Prirodzene, musíte opatrne komentovať v kódovej slučke!

... alebo rovnakým spôsobom - podobne ako vyššie uvedený príklad pre CSS ... t.j. táto / * kód * / možnosť komentovania bude fungovať pre kódy CSS aj JS!

Ale týmto spôsobom môžete komentovať rozsiahlejšie vysvetlenie kódu PHP, niekde medzi jeho hlavnými príkladmi ...

Môžete tiež komentovať v php slučkách takto, ak je kód zmiešaný ... php a nejako html

Podobne ako vyššie:

Napríklad nejaký druh funkcie ... niekde vo všeobecnom kóde (alebo slučka v html):- môžete komentovať, to znamená pridať svoj vlastný štítok takto:

alebo takto: jednoriadková možnosť...

inteligencia:

php kód nie je viditeľný v žiadnom zdrojovom kóde!! vidno len jeho funkčný výsledok - odpracovanie!

Vo všeobecnosti, to je všetko, čo som dnes chcel nahlásiť!

Teraz môžete experimentovať... Veľa šťastia.

A samozrejme si prečítajte články na stránke a prihláste sa na odber:
Zdieľam svoju trpkú skúsenosť - nejaké vedomosti, pre vašu sladkú pohodu))

... mesto webmasterov Mikhalika.ru© - Jednoducho s WordPress